average use

The data indicates that the most common recorded mileage for the BMW X6 (2008-15) XDRIVE30D model is between 100,000 and 110,000 miles, representing 13.8% of vehicles. Notably, a significant portion of vehicles—over 35%—are clustered within the 80,000 to 120,000 mile range, suggesting that many cars are driven this amount before further mileage increases. There is also a smaller but notable percentage of vehicles with mileage below 10,000 miles (3.7%) and above 200,000 miles (around 1.6%), highlighting the presence of both low-mileage nearly new vehicles and high-mileage, possibly well-used cars. Interestingly, the distribution shows a gradual decline in vehicle numbers at very high mileage brackets, with the lowest frequencies found above 200,000 miles.

vehicle values

The data presents the distribution of private sale price estimates for a BMW X6 (2008-15) XDRIVE30D 5DR SUV 3.0 DPF 245 EU5 AUTO8 in the UK. The most common price range is between £6,000 and £7,000, accounting for 13.8% of valuations, followed closely by those between £5,000 and £6,000 at 12.2%. Notably, a significant portion of valuations—around 60%—fall below £10,000, indicating that many of these vehicles are considered to be in the lower-to-mid price bracket in private sales. Very few vehicles are valued above £17,000, with only 1.6% estimated between £17,000 and £18,000, and minimal valuations approaching £20,000. Overall, the pattern suggests that these vehicles are generally appreciated in the lower to mid-range market, with a declining number of higher-valued vehicles.

colour popularity

The data indicates that the most common main paint colour for the BMW X6 (2008-15) XDRIVE30D 5DR SUV 3.0 DPF 245 EU5 AUTO8 is black, accounting for approximately 40.7% of vehicles. White and grey are also relatively prevalent, representing 33.9% and 8.5%, respectively. Notably, vibrant colours such as red, green, purple, and blue are less common, with red comprising only 2.6% and purple just 0.5%. An interesting observation is the low occurrence of less conventional or distinctive colours, suggesting that this model predominantly features neutral or classic shades, likely appealing to a broad market segment seeking understated aesthetics.

ownership cycle

The data on registered keepers for the BMW X6 (2008-15) XDRIVE30D indicates that the most common number of keepers is five, accounting for 21.2% of vehicles. A significant portion of vehicles, about 54.6%, have between three and five keepers, suggesting a relatively stable ownership pattern. Notably, a smaller percentage of vehicles have higher numbers of keepers, such as 8 or 9, each representing around 6-5% of the fleet. Interestingly, a small segment (0.5%) has as many as 13 or 20 keepers, which may point to vehicles with more complex ownership histories. Overall, the data suggests that most vehicles tend to change hands a few times rather than undergoing frequent or lengthy ownership durations.

engine choices

The data indicates that the majority of the BMW X6 (2008-15) XDRIVE30D 5DR SUV 3.0 DPF 245 EU5 AUTO8 models are equipped with a 2.993-liter engine, accounting for 90.5% of the sample. A smaller portion, 9%, have a 2.996-liter engine, while an extremely limited 0.5% feature an engine capacity of 195cc, which is likely an anomaly or data entry error. Notably, all vehicles in the sample utilize diesel fuel exclusively, reflecting the model's diesel engine preference.
